The 2011/12 Bundesliga was Borussia Dortmund's second consecutive title under the management of Jürgen Klopp—having also won in 2010/11—and one of the most exciting and celebrated teams in European football over the last decade. That squad was a masterpiece of sporting construction without major investment: Robert Lewandowski as an implacable goalscoring reference, Mario Götze as Germany's most precocious talent, Ivan Perišić on the wings, Shinji Kagawa as the creative engine, Mats Hummels as the defensive leader, and Kevin Großkreutz as the soul of the neighborhood—the local player, the fan in boots. BVB finished the season with 81 points, 16 more than the runner-up, in a display of dominance that confirmed Klopp's project was no accident, but a revolution.
